Chicken and Broccoli (Chinese Takeout Style)

This classic Chinese takeout dish is a favorite for many. It’s a simple stir-fry of chicken and broccoli in a savory sauce. It’s easy to make and can be served with steamed rice or noodles.

Ingredients:

– 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
– 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 2 cups broccoli florets
– 1/4 cup low-sodium soy sauce
– 2 tablespoons oyster sauce
– 2 tablespoons honey
– 1 teaspoon sesame oil
– 1/4 teaspoon ground ginger
– 1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es

Instructions:

1. Heat the o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
2. Add the chicken and garlic and cook until the chicken is golden brown and cooked through, about 5 minutes.
3. Add the broccoli and cook for another 3 minutes.
4. In a small bowl, whisk together the soy sauce, oyster sauce, honey, sesame oil, ginger, and red pepper flakes.
5. Pour the sauce over the chicken and broccoli and stir to combine.
6. Cook for another 2 minutes, or until the sauce is thick and bubbly.
7. Serve over steamed rice or noodles.
